The Queen of Rock and Roll turns 81 this month
Tina (Anna- Mae Bullock) was born in Tennesse and lived in a town known as Nutbush in Tennesse.
She married Ike Turner in 1962. Together they had a string of hits and were known as Ike and Tina Turner Revue.
She collaborated with artists such as Bryan Adams, Mick Jagger, Rod Stewart, David Bowie among others.
Tina's stage performances have always exploded with energy and her distinctive voice has given her an edge over other female singers. Despite the struggles and abusive relationship with her ex-husband Ike Turner, Tina rose to fame making Rock & Roll music sound classy and trendy. She continues to be 'The Best.'
